10641
European Countries Tenders
Location :
Switzerland - Switzerland, Switzerland
construction work
10642
European Countries Tenders
Location :
Switzerland - Switzerland, Switzerland
electrical engineering installation works
10643
European Countries Tenders
Location :
Switzerland - Switzerland, Switzerland
construction work
10644
European Countries Tenders
Location :
Switzerland - Switzerland, Switzerland
library and archive services
10645
European Countries Tenders
Location :
Switzerland - Switzerland, Switzerland
electricity distribution and control apparatus
10646
European Countries Tenders
Location :
Switzerland - Switzerland, Switzerland
construction work
10647
European Countries Tenders
Location :
Switzerland - Switzerland, Switzerland
construction work
10648
European Countries Tenders
Location :
Switzerland - Switzerland, Switzerland
construction work
10649
European Countries Tenders
Location :
Switzerland - Switzerland, Switzerland
supply of software-related services
10650
European Countries Tenders
Location :
Switzerland - Switzerland, Switzerland
supply of freezers